What Are 6 ft Containers?
A 6 ft container is a compact storage option that is typically used for shipping and storage purposes. Determining 6 feet container feet in length, these containers can vary in width-- most frequently 4 feet or 8 feet-- and height. In general, they are created to be weatherproof and durable, making them ideal for numerous applications consisting of domestic relocations, construction sites, and even short-term storage during occasions.

Residential Storage
6 ft storage container ft containers serve as ideal storage spaces for property owners who need extra room to save seasonal items, furniture, or home appliances throughout renovations.
2. Construction Sites
With the growing demand for building, these containers are frequently employed on websites for secure storage of tools and products. Their compact size fits easily into tight areas.
3. Occasion Management
Event organizers often utilize 6 ft containers to shop devices, materials, or product throughout large gatherings, celebrations, and trade convention.
4. Retail
Retailers can use small containers for supplemental stock, specifically throughout peak seasons when rack space is at a premium.
5. Short-lived Moves
These containers can likewise serve as short-lived systems for individuals moving their homes. They can be put on site and used as a holding area until the move is completed.

Area Efficiency
The compact nature of 6 ft containers enables them to be utilized in smaller areas where full-sized containers wouldn't fit. This is especially advantageous on building and construction websites or in property settings where space is limited.
2. Lower Cost
Due to their size, 6 ft containers are normally more affordable than bigger containers. This makes them available for small companies or individuals who need storage without breaking the bank.
3. Flexible Use
As formerly pointed out, these containers can serve numerous purposes-- from temporary storage services for moving homes to protecting tools on construction websites.
4. Durable and Secure
Built from high-quality materials, a 6 ft container is created to stand up to harsh climate condition and keep stored products safe from theft and damage.
5. Easy Accessibility
Smaller containers can be more quickly transported and placed in different locations. Their size makes filling and dumping simpler, which can conserve time and labor costs.
6. Personalization Options
Numerous personalization alternatives are available, including extra shelving, ventilation, and insulation, catering to particular requirements.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)Q1: How much can a 6 ft container hold?
A 6 ft container typically has a weight capability varying from 2,000 to 3,000 pounds. The actual storage volume will depend upon the container's width and height, however typically, you can expect to accumulate to 200-300 cubic feet of products.
Q2: Can I rent a 6 ft container?
Yes, numerous companies provide rental choices for short-term or long-term use. Renting is a practical service for individuals who might not require a container completely.
Q3: Are 6 ft containers weatherproof?
A lot of 6 ft containers are designed to be weatherproof and rust-resistant, supplying a durable storage option for both indoor and outside use.
Q4: How do I transport a 6 ft container?
Transporting a 6 ft container can be done using a flatbed truck or specialized container 6ft transport lorries. It is important to hire specialists who are geared up to deal with storage containers securely.
Q5: Can I customize my 6 ft container?
Definitely! Many container suppliers provide modification alternatives, including shelving, lighting, ventilation, and even paint tasks depending upon your requirements.
Q6: Are 6 ft containers protect?
Yes, 6 ft containers normally come with enhanced locking mechanisms, making them a safe storage option for valuable products.
